EA Bringing Games to Nintendo NX

nintendo nx

Electronic Arts is planning to bring games to the Nintendo NX. According to EA executive vice president Patrick Soderlund in an interview with Game Informer, Nintendo deserves to have success.

“Nintendo is such an instrumental part of our whole industry,” Soderlund said. “They deserve to be successful, and they deserve to be a major player in the business, given their pedigree. It’s not only the machines that they’ve built, but also the IPs they’ve brought to market. There are very few companies like Nintendo.”

Soderlund also said he couldn’t share the specifics of EA’s plans for the NX because the system hasn’t been formally announced. He did say, “Whenever they bring something to market that we see an addressable market for, we’ll be there.”

EA launched four titles for the Wii U in 2013 but gave up on the system soon after. That’s in contrast to the original Wii, which saw 78 titles throughout the console’s life cycle.

The Nintendo NX is scheduled to go on sale in March 2017.
